Our Missions

Ecosystem Recovery

Ecosystem Recovery

We work to restore damaged ecosystems through reforestation, soil rehabilitation, and reintroduction of native species in war-affected landscapes.

Environmental Monitoring

Environmental Monitoring

Our teams gather critical environmental metrics — including water toxicity, soil contamination, and air quality — using mobile labs and sensor stations.

Community Empowerment

Community Empowerment

We empower local communities with the knowledge, tools, and training to take part in post-conflict ecological protection and long-term resilience.

Wildlife Tracking

Wildlife Tracking

We monitor animal movement across conflict zones using satellite collars and drone observation to assess displacement and threats to biodiversity.

Contamination Detection

Contamination Detection

We use drone imagery, satellite data, and on-site sampling to detect chemical, radiological, and biological hazards — ensuring timely and safe cleanup operations.

Policy Advocacy

Policy & Advocacy

We work with national and international bodies to embed environmental protection in conflict response strategies and hold violators accountable.
